Manejando datos

Plataforma de Inteligencia de negocio: tutorial de MongoDB Aggregation Pipeline

Posted by in MongoDB

Este artículo es una traducción al español del artículo original de toptal, con quien se ha empezado una colaboración, y en concreto, este tutorial está dedicado a aprender sobre MongoDB, una base de datos NoSQL de la que ya os hablé hace mucho tiempo. Utilizar datos para resolver preguntas y cuestiones es a lo que los investigadores se dedican cuando sus esfuerzos están dirigidos por los datos. El procesamiento de grandes volúmenes de datos es todo un desafío, y cuanto más datos, mayor es el desafío. Adicionalmente, las investigaciones casi…read more

MS Access to MySQL – SQLite Migration Tool

Posted by in Bases de datos, Noticias

En esta entrada les presento la herramienta MS Access to MySQL – SQLite Migration Tool, de creación propia y que ahora hago pública, cuyo objetivo es Migrar la estructura y el contenido de una base de datos MS Access a MySQL y también a SQLite. Se trata de una herramienta que facilita la migración de archivos de Microsoft Access a bases de datos MySQL o MariaDB y a SQLite. La primera versión pública es la versión 2.2, ya que ahora es cuando considero que está la herramienta más madura (por…read more

0

Desafios para 2017

Posted by in Bases de datos

Feliz navidad y feliz 2017!!!! Parece que fue ayer cuando escribí los desafios para 2016, y ya estamos terminando el año, así que toca hacer recuento de lo que hemos hecho bien, y lo que nos hemos dejado en el tintero. Retos conseguidos en 2016 Sin duda, 2016 ha sido un año donde muchos de los temas que se han tocado han estado relacionados con la privacidad y sus datos, donde he intentado (no se si con más o menos éxito) quitar la venda a mis lectores de cuan importantes…read more

Common_schema: tareas repetitivas con foreach

Posted by in MariaDB, MySQL

Aunque hemos hablado varias veces de este framework de MySQL-MariaDB, hoy os traigo una nueva función, muy útil cuando necesitas realizar tareas repetitivas basadas en consultas. Se trata de utilizar call foreach. Aquí expongo un ejemplo práctico de cómo lo he usado yo para ejecutar una tarea concreta: reemplazar todos los valores nulos a cero en una tabla con un monton de campos. Localizando los campos de la tabla Para localizar los campos a los que aplicar la rutina, qué mejor que utilizar information_schema, que es una de las bases…read more

Mecanismo de los índices en MySQL-MariaDB

Posted by in Bases de datos, MariaDB, MySQL

En pasadas entradas sobre MySQL os conté primero la ventaja a nivel de rendimiento que supone tener índices en las bases de datos, y posteriormente, cómo forzar a MySQL a usar un índice que no es el que MySQL estima que es el mejor. La entrada de hoy profundiza en cómo esel mecanismo de los índices en las tablas de MySQL-MariaDB, con el fin de que lo tengas presente para la optimización de consultas. Aunque esta entrada es bastante teórica, creo que es muy interesante que prestes toda la atención…read more